Output 84d466e8503dd5a57d63f366aa9f5936c10955000b19f1842a55127f7ec04853:0

value
260899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d5e2af6cf171dc4276356b13aa36ddec37fda89 OP_EQUAL
address
3MsW4qJqfG3JDZANL2hg8Mdgc7VyPhoWSH
transaction
84d466e8503dd5a57d63f366aa9f5936c10955000b19f1842a55127f7ec04853
spent
true